Top 5 Flowers For Valentine’s Day
Valentine’s is all about celebrating love and expressing heartfelt gestures. Therefore, like each flower has its own special meaning, below are the names of the top 5 flowers and their meanings:
1. Red Roses
Meaning: The Classic Symbol of Love
Red roses are universally recognised as the ultimate symbol of romantic love and desire. Their deep red colour represents passion, commitment, and deep emotional connection. Giving red roses on Valentine’s Day sends a clear and powerful message of love, making them a popular choice for partners, spouses, and long-term relationships. Whether you are gifting a single rose or a luxurious bouquet, red roses never fail to make the best romantic statement.
2. Tulips
Meaning: Perfect Love and New Beginnings
Tulips are known for their simple beauty and strong symbolic meaning. They represent perfect love and are often associated with new beginnings and fresh emotions. Red tulips express deep love, while pink tulips convey affection and care. Their graceful shape and vibrant colours make them a modern and stylish choice for Valentine’s Day, particularly for couples who appreciate understated romance.
3. Carnations
Meaning: Fascination and Affection
Carnations are often overlooked, yet they are known to carry powerful romantic meanings. The Red carnations symbolise deep love and admiration, while pink carnations represent gratitude and affection. Their ruffled petals and long vase life make them a charming and practical Valentine’s Day option for expressing heartfelt emotions.
4. Lilies
Meaning: Elegance and Devotion
Lilies are elegant flowers that symbolise devotion, purity, and admiration. Their striking appearance and pleasant fragrance make them a sophisticated Valentine’s Day gift. White lilies represent purity and commitment, while pink lilies convey compassion and romantic interest. Lilies are ideal for expressing sincere emotions and deep respect within a relationship.
5. Orchids
Meaning: Luxury, Desire, and Lasting Love
Orchids are associated with beauty, strength, and luxury. They symbolise love that is rare and meaningful, making them a thoughtful Valentine’s Day gift. Orchids also represent desire and long-lasting affection, which makes them suitable for serious relationships. Their long-lasting blooms ensure your romantic gesture is remembered well beyond Valentine’s Day.
